Psalms 114
114:1
When Israel went out of Egypt, the house of Jacob from a people of strange language;
عِنْدَ خُرُوجِ إِسْرَائِيلَ مِنْ مِصْرَ، وَبَيْتِ يَعْقُوبَ مِنْ شَعْبٍأَعْجَمَ،
114:2
Judah was his sanctuary, and Israel his dominion.
كَانَ يَهُوذَا مَقْدِسَهُ، وَإِسْرَائِيلُ مَحَلَّ سُلْطَانِهِ.
114:3
The sea saw it, and fled: Jordan was driven back.
الْبَحْرُ رَآهُ فَهَرَبَ. الأُرْدُنُّ رَجَعَ إِلَى خَلْفٍ.
114:4
The mountains skipped like rams, and the little hills like lambs.
الْجِبَالُ قَفَزَتْ مِثْلَ الْكِبَاشِ، وَالآكامُ مِثْلَ حُمْلاَنِ الْغَنَمِ.
114:5
What ailed thee, O thou sea, that thou fleddest? thou Jordan, that thou wast driven back?
مَا لَكَ أَيُّهَا الْبَحْرُ قَدْ هَرَبْتَ ؟ وَمَا لَكَ أَيُّهَا الأُرْدُنُّ قَدْ رَجَعْتَ إِلَى خَلْفٍ ؟
114:6
Ye mountains, that ye skipped like rams; and ye little hills, like lambs?
وَمَا لَكُنَّ أَيَّتُهَا الْجِبَالُ قَدْ قَفَزْتُنَّ مِثْلَ الْكِبَاشِ، وَأَيَّتُهَا التِّلاَلُ مِثْلَ حُمْلاَنِ الْغَنَمِ؟
114:7
Tremble, thou earth, at the presence of the Lord, at the presence of the God of Jacob;
أَيَّتُهَا الأَرْضُ تَزَلْزَلِي مِنْ قُدَّامِ الرَّبِّ، مِنْ قُدَّامِ إِلهِ يَعْقُوبَ!
114:8
Which turned the rock into a standing water, the flint into a fountain of waters.
الْمُحَوِّلِ الصَّخْرَةَ إِلَى غُدْرَانِ مِيَاهٍ، الصَّوَّانَ إِلَى يَنَابِيعِ مِيَاهٍ.
